Como funciona algoritmo DES?

Índice

Como funciona algoritmo DES?

Como funciona algoritmo DES?

Basicamente o DES funciona através dos seguintes passos:

  1. Uma substituição fixa, chamada de permutação inicial, de 64 bits em 64 bits;
  2. Uma transformação, que depende de uma chave de 48 bits, e que preserva a metade direita;
  3. Uma troca das duas metades de 32 bits cada uma;
  4. Repetem-se os passos 2 e 3 durante 16 vezes;

O que é um algoritmo DES?

O Data Encryption Standard (DES) é algoritmo criptográfico simétrico selecionado como FIPS oficial (Federal Information Processing Standard) pelo governo dos EUA em 1976 e que foi utilizado em larga escala internacionalmente.

O que é chave DES?

Data Encryption Standart(DES): O propósito era criar um método padrão para proteção de dados. ... Cada bloco de 64 bits de dados sofre de 1 a 16 iterações (16 é o padrão DES). Para cada iteração um pedaço de 48 bits da chave de 56 bits entra no bloco de encriptação representado pelo retângulo tracejado no diagrama acima.

Como funciona o AES?

O AES usa uma estrutura de loop para reordenar repetidamente dados ou permutações. O loop substitui uma unidade de dados por outra para dados de entrada. A rotina de criptografia usa a mesma chave para criptografar e descriptografar os dados e aplicar essa chave aos blocos de dados de comprimento fixo.

Quais as diferenças entre o algoritmo de Feistel E o DES?

Uma grande quantidade das cifras de bloco utilizam este esquema, incluindo o Data Encryption Standard (DES). A estrutura de Feistel tem a vantagem de que as operações de cifragem e decifragem são muito semelhantes, sendo idênticas em alguns casos, necessitando apenas da utilização das chaves na ordem inversa.

Quais as características do algoritmo de criptografia DES?

DES é tipo de cifra em bloco, ou seja, um algoritmo que toma uma String de tamanho fixo de um texto plano e a transforma, através de uma série de complicadas operações, em um texto cifrado de mesmo tamanho. No caso do DES, o tamanho do bloco é 64 bits.

O que é uma chave RSA?

RSA (Rivest-Shamir-Adleman) é um dos primeiros sistemas de criptografia de chave pública e é amplamente utilizado para transmissão segura de dados. Neste sistema de criptografia, a chave de encriptação é pública e é diferente da chave de decriptação que é secreta (privada).

Qual é a diferença entre rijndael e AES?

O AES é uma variante do Rijndael, com um tamanho de bloco fixo de 128 bits e um tamanho de chave de 128, 1 bits. Em contraste, Rijndael "per se" é especificado com tamanhos de bloco e chave que podem ser qualquer múltiplo de 32 bits, com um mínimo de 128 e um máximo de 256 bits.

Postagens relacionadas: